  • Job Summary

    In this role, you coordinate courses in Game and Mixed Reality, further develop curricula, supervise students, and promote interdisciplinary projects in software and game development.

    Job Technologies

    Your role in the team

    • Coordination of all teaching activities as well as internal and external instructors in the department, in close and constructive consultation with the program directors.
    • Planning and organizing personnel deployment within the department in coordination with the department management, program directors, and the Head of Research.
    • Implementation of the department's quality objectives in teaching, in particular the optimization and evaluation of teaching and support of program directors in enhancing teaching quality.
    • Subject-specific collaboration on updating and further developing the curricula in the study and teaching programs within the department (possibly also cross-departmentally).
    • Promotion of interdisciplinarity.
    • Support in positioning the degree programs within the department as well as collaboration on marketing activities for the degree programs.
    • Teach foundational and advanced courses in Software/Game Development and Mixed Reality in the Bachelor's and Master's degree programs in Code and Interactive Systems, up to 16 hours per week (also in English).
    • Participation in the coordination and development of courses and teaching materials in the field of Game and Mixed Reality.
    • Supervision of academic papers and student projects.
    • Participation in the acquisition and execution of (research) projects in the degree program.
    • Academic and organizational contribution to the degree program or participation in the qualitative development of Bachelor's and Master's degree programs.
    • Development and maintenance of corporate and economic contacts (partnerships, projects, internships).

    Our expectations of you

    Education

    • Completed university degree (Diploma, Master's) in Computer Science. Relevant PhD preferred.
    • At least 3 years of relevant professional experience outside the university sector (minimum 50% full-time equivalent over three years) since obtaining a university degree.

    Qualifications

    • Programming: object-oriented programming in C# or C++, engine scripting, gameplay programming.
    • Graphics: Computer graphics (e.g., OpenGL, Vulkan, CUDA), Neural Rendering, Gaussian Splatting.
    • Generative AI, VR/AR/MR: (Generative) AI for interactive systems/games, Virtual Reality, Augmented Reality, Mixed Reality.
    • Pedagogical-didactic competence.
    • Excellent practical skills and the ability to collaborate in multidisciplinary tasks.
    • German and English language skills corresponding to the position.
    • Sensitivity and mindfulness in dealing with diversity.
    • High communicative and social skills.

    Experience

    • Relevant practical experience and in-depth knowledge in several of the following areas: game development: game development, game engines, tools, and workflows.
    • Game Design: Mechanics, Balancing, Level Design, Experience Design.
    • Several years of teaching experience at the university level.
    • Research experience and publications are an advantage.

    What we offer

    • Working hours: 40 hours per week / Teaching load up to 16 hours per week.
    • Work location: Urstein Campus.
    • Start: September 1, 2026.
    • Remuneration: from € 67,942 gross annual total salary (remuneration considering qualifications and professional experience).
    • Allowance for Department Head: € 350,- 12 times per year.
    • Professorship: The title of FH-Professor*in is awarded through an academic procedure independent of the employment contract by the FH College. The required proof in the areas of teaching and research must be provided.
    • Application deadline: 24.08.2026.
